Murata Power Solutions is a leading provider of power conversion products that are sustainable and efficient. We are focused in two transformative technology, macro market segments; Server, Storage, Networking (SSN) and E-Mobility, including electric vehicles, robotics and energy storage. Ranked amongst the world's top 5 suppliers of breakthrough power electronics, we design and manufacture the industry's broadest offering of standard products and are a market leading designer of custom power solutions.

Well known for the quality of its products and workforce, we can provide you the opportunity to work with talented people and a management team focused on growth and the ongoing development of leading-edge technologies for many of the world's major OEM's.

Position Summary:


  • At the Toronto Design Centre, our Product Development teams provide solutions to our customers through the design and development of AC-DC and DC-DC power supplies.
